LANCASTER, Pa. – The No. 10 Franklin & Marshall men's squash team battled, but ultimately fell to No. 11 Dartmouth by a 7-2 score on Thursday evening at the Mayser Center.
The Diplomats dropped to 3-3 on the season, while the Big Green improved to 2-0 with their other win coming in a 5-4 upset of No. 2 Harvard a week ago.
By the Numbers
All but one matchup on the day went beyond three games, with four reaching five frames. A pair of games on the evening went past 11 points, with Ricardo Machado (No. 9) falling in an opening-game marathon by a 17-15 score and Silvio Soom (No. 3) being edged out by an 14-12 mark in the decisive fifth. Kareem Nabil Abdel Mawla improved to a team-best 4-1 with his 3-2 win at the No. 7 position.
Heading into the match, the Diplomats held a two-match winning streak over the Big Green, dating back to the 2011-12 season.

Kenny Named POTW
Freshman Sean Kenny earned the men's Harrow Sports College Squash Player of the Week award for the week ending on 11/22. Kenny garnered the distinction after battling back from a 1-0 deficit against Princeton's Komron Shayegan to take the match by a 3-2 score (0-11, 9-11, 11-4, 11-8, 11-5) at the No. 5 spot in F&M's 5-4 win on Nov. 21.
